I have Pay and Go phone with a large balance that I do not want to lose. I need to take my existing number (via PAC code) to a new network but could retain a presence on o2 with my current phone AND BALANCE and a new number. Alternatively use the balance to make a purchase from o2? Anyone have any advice please.

You can't keep your balance if you port away from O2.
The only way to keep it is if you move to a contract with o2, in which case up to £350 can be transferred.
If you want to buy stuff you can use charge to mobile https://www.o2.co.uk/charge-to-mobile or make charitable donations from your phone.
